window open() 메서드 open()메서드는 새 브라우저 창을 엽니다. 팁 : close()메서드는 브라우저를 닫습니다. 문법 window.open(URL,name,specs,replace) 파라메터 1.URL URL : 오픈할 페이지의 URL 입력, 만약 URL값이 없으면 "about:blank" 로 오픈 됨. 2.name name : 대상 속성이나 윈도우의 이름을 지정. _blank : 새창으로 로드 (기본) _parent : 부모 프레임에 로드 _self : 현재 페이지에 _top : URL을 로드할 수 있는 프레임셋에. name : 윈도우의 이름(title과는 다르며 title로 지정되지 않음) 3.specs specs : ,(콤마)로 구분된 목록 다음과 같은 값이 지원 된다. channe..
새로고침 방지 샘플 스크립트 졸리다..
정규식 한글 체크 korTextCheck 함수 : 정규식에 한글을 대입하여 match로 조회. ( T : 한글 ) korCodeCheck 함수 : 키 코드 값으로 조회 서버의 MIME등이 맞지 않거나 문제가 있을경우 이걸로 대체. ( T : 한글 ) 쓰기 어렵게 요상하게 정리 해 놓았거나, 소스 드래그를 방지(개인적으로 어이없는 짓이라고 생각 함)하는 블로거 들이 있어서 가장 검증된 정규화식을 대입해 함수화 해서 만듬.. 이게 뭐 대단한거라고 왜 이렇게 방지를 걸어놨는지. 아래 코드를 보고 입맛에 맞게 가감하여 활용. 소스보기) 결과 truefalse truefalse
1. 브라우저 종류 판별 여러가지 방법이 있지만 현재 (2014.07월) 까지 대다수 브라우저와 특히 IE계열 7,8,9,10,11을 판별 해 내는 간단한 함수를 만들어보고 IE의 경우 프론트엔드 개발자를 지독하게 괴롭히는 호환성 보기 체크 여부까지 검사하는 방법을 알아보겠다. 2. IE버전을 구분 할 때에는 navigator.appName을 사용하지 말것 예전에는 IE의 경우 최초 navigator.appName 메서드로 접근하여 "Microsoft Internet Explorer" 라는 문자열로 알 수 있었는데 IE11의 경우 navigator.appName 이름이 Netscape로 나온다. 쌩뚱맞게 Netscape로 나오는 이유는? -> 본인도 모르겠다. 표로 정리) IE 버전 navigator.a..
indexOf 메서드 String 개체 안에서 부분 문자열이 처음 나오는 문자 위치를 반환합니다. strObj.indexOf(subString[, startIndex]) 인수strObj 필수적인 요소. String 개체 또는 리터럴입니다. subString 필수적인 요소. String 개체 안에서 검색하려는 부분 문자열입니다. startIndex 선택적인 요소. String 개체 안에서 검색을 시작할 인덱스를 지정하는 정수 값입니다. 생략하면 문자열의 처음부터 검색을 시작합니다. 참고indexOf 메서드는 String 개체 안에 있는 부분 문자열의 시작점을 나타내는 정수값을 반환합니다. 부분 문자열이 없으면 -1이 반환됩니다. startindex 값이 음수이면 startindex는 0으로 처리됩니다. 이..
1. 자바스크립트에서 canvas ID를 가져올때는 직접 document객체에 접근해서 정의한다. //ex) 캔버스를 생성var can = document.getElementById('canvasID');CANVAS["context"] = can.getContext('2d'); //ex) raphael을 생성var canvas = document.getElementById('svg'+_pCount);var raphael = new Raphael(canvas, 500, 500);var myBall = raphael.ball(100, 100, 80, Math.random());function myBall... 2. css 속성 접근은 제이쿼에서 직접 셀렉트하여 접근한다.위에서 할당된 can, canvas변수..